As the Sunflowers Grow

As the Sunflowers Grow

Stephen Randall
0/5 ( ratings)
"As the Sunflowers Grow" is the third book of poems by this English author and was compiled over several months at his home in Wiltshire, England and also while on holiday in Italy. The style of the book is written in lyrical prose covering a variety of topics which the author feels strongly about. The poems move through different themes ranging from love and passion to heart break and to the futility of war and people's suffering to the every day things that surrounds all of us in our daily lives. The book can be enjoyed by people of all ages and allows the reader to delve into life in the modern world. Stephen Randall was born in Bath, England in 1966 to an English father and an Italian mother. This is his third poem book following on from "Four Seasons in One Day" and "On the Outside, Looking In!" The book continues the author's theme of describing the every day events in today's frustrating world.
